A physician who focuses on the care and management of adults with congenital heart disease (ACHD) is specially trained to navigate the complexities of this condition. ACHD specialists have a thorough understanding of the anatomy, physiology, surgical repairs, and potential long-term complications associated with congenital heart disease. They leverage this expertise to effectively manage patients who may also experience acquired heart conditions, including heart failure, arrhythmias, and pulmonary hypertension.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
